Zone: Eastern Rural ZoneLocation: Carbonear General HospitalLaboratory Technologist ILaboratory Services- Core LabTemporary Full-time (until October 31, 2027, with the possibility of extension)NAPE LX00501RP1Hours: 70 biweekly (8-hour shift work; days, evenings, nights, weekends; rotating)Salary: LX-27 (CAD $32.16 - CAD $40.20 per hour)Competition Number: VAC0027018Posted Date: 2026-07-20Closing Date: Open until filled.Job SummaryRotating through Biochemistry, Hematology, Transfusion Medicine and if required, Microbiology, the Laboratory Technologist I performs routine and complex laboratory testing; performs phlebotomy when required; runs Quality Control following established procedures and keeps appropriate documentation. Performs routine preventative maintenance procedures on various laboratory instruments and keeps appropriate documentation. The candidate promotes Patient Safety initiatives through strict application of NL Health Services Policies. Performs other related duties, as required.Job DemandsBy applying for this job, you acknowledge an understanding that regular requirements and demands of this job include (but are not limited to):Occasionally lifts and/or unload objects weighing up to 30 lbs. Regularly stands or sits for extended periods, requiring constant repetitive movement of upper extremities and walking to deliver reports/results. Visual and auditory concentration are constant and eye/hand coordination and higher than normal levels of attentiveness are required.Job Qualifications Graduation from a recognized (accredited) program with a diploma in Medical Laboratory Technology or a degree in Medical Laboratory Science is required.Current and continuing certification with the Canadian Society for Medical Laboratory Science (CSMLS) as a general MLT or applicable subject MLT is required.Current and continuing registration with the NL Council of Health Professionals is required.A satisfactory record of work performance is required.*The successful applicant must be willing to complete at the first available opportunity refresher courses at the request of the employer.
